When Should You Update Your Estate Planning?​​

  • Has your attorney retired, died or moved on? Is it time to find a new, experienced attorney?

  • Has the makeup of your family changed in recent years?  If so, should your Will be changed?

  • What problems will arise when you become partially or totally incapacitated? 

  • Who will make your medical and financial decisions if you can no longer do so on your own due to an illness or accident? 

  • Do you want the Court appointing a Guardian or do you want to name someone you trust?

  • How will your assisted living and long term care costs be paid?

  • How will things go between your family members when you become disabled? When you die?

  • Should you include trust provisions in your Will for young heirs or for a spouse or child with special needs, or to avoid estate taxes?

  • Are the correct beneficiaries designated in the right order to receive your remaining retirement benefits and life insurance after you die? 

  • Where is your original Last Will and Testament stored?

  • What legal steps will be needed after you die? 

  • Who will take charge if you don't plan for these things?
